How To Move Microsoft Access To SQL Server LA

Value of Microsoft Gain Access To in Your Organization
Mid to large companies might have hundreds to hundreds of home computer. Each desktop has conventional software application that permits team to accomplish computing tasks without the treatment of the organization's IT department. This supplies the main tenet of desktop computer computing: encouraging customers to increase efficiency as well as reduced expenses via decentralized computing.

As the globe's most preferred desktop computer data source, Microsoft Access is used in nearly all organizations that utilize Microsoft Windows. As customers come to be much more competent in the procedure of these applications, they start to identify solutions to company jobs that they themselves could apply. The all-natural development of this procedure is that spreadsheets and databases are created and also maintained by end-users to manage their daily tasks.

This vibrant permits both performance and also dexterity as customers are equipped to fix organisation troubles without the treatment of their company's Information Technology framework. Microsoft Accessibility fits into this room by providing a desktop computer data source atmosphere where end-users could promptly create data source applications with tables, queries, types and also reports. Access is excellent for inexpensive single customer or workgroup database applications.

But this power features a cost. As more users make use of Microsoft Accessibility to manage their job, issues of information safety and security, reliability, maintainability, scalability and also management become severe. The people that built these solutions are seldom educated to be database experts, programmers or system managers. As data sources outgrow the capabilities of the original writer, they have to move right into a more durable environment.

While some people consider this a reason why end-users should not ever make use of Microsoft Gain access to, we consider this to be the exemption rather than the regulation. A lot of Microsoft Accessibility databases are produced by end-users as well as never ever have to finish to the following degree. Executing a strategy to create every end-user database "skillfully" would certainly be a massive waste of resources.

For the rare Microsoft Gain access to databases that are so successful that they need to develop, SQL Server uses the following all-natural development. Without shedding the existing financial investment in the application (table designs, data, inquiries, types, records, macros and also components), information can be relocated to SQL Server and also the Access database linked to it. Once in SQL Server, other platforms such as Visual Studio.NET can be used to create Windows, web and/or mobile options. The Access database application may be completely changed or a crossbreed service could be produced.

For more information, review our paper Microsoft Accessibility within an Organization's Overall Data source Method.

Microsoft Gain Access To and SQL Database Architectures

Microsoft Accessibility is the premier desktop computer data source item readily available for Microsoft Windows. Given that its intro in 1992, Accessibility has supplied a flexible system for newbies and power individuals to produce single-user and small workgroup data source applications.

Microsoft Accessibility has actually enjoyed excellent success since it originated the idea of tipping individuals through a difficult task with the use of Wizards. This, along with an instinctive question designer, one of the best desktop coverage tools and the incorporation of macros and also a coding environment, all add to making Access the very best choice for desktop data source advancement.

Since Accessibility is developed to be easy to use and also approachable, it was never ever intended as a platform for the most dependable and robust applications. As a whole, upsizing must occur when these qualities become vital for the application. Fortunately, the versatility of Gain access to enables you to upsize to SQL Server in a selection of ways, from a quick cost-efficient, data-moving scenario to full application redesign.

Gain access to gives an abundant selection of information architectures that allow it to handle data in a range of ways. When taking into consideration an upsizing task, it is necessary to comprehend the selection of means Accessibility could be set up to utilize its native Jet database format as well as SQL Server in both single and multi-user atmospheres.

Gain access to as well as the Jet Engine
Microsoft Access has click to read more its own database engine-- the Microsoft Jet Database Engine (additionally called the ACE with Accessibility 2007's intro of the ACCDB style). Jet was created from the beginning to sustain solitary individual and multiuser file sharing on a local area network. Data sources have a maximum dimension of 2 GB, although an Access database could link to various other databases using linked tables and also numerous backend databases to workaround the 2 GB limit.

But Access is more than a database engine. It is additionally an application development environment that allows users to make questions, develop types and also reports, as well as write macros and also Visual Fundamental for Applications (VBA) module code to automate an application. In its default configuration, Access uses Jet inside to save its layout items such as kinds, records, macros, as well as modules as well as makes use of Jet to save all table information.

One of the primary advantages of Accessibility upsizing is that you can revamp your application to continue to use its kinds, records, macros and modules, as well as replace the Jet Engine with SQL Server. This permits the best of both worlds: the simplicity of use of Access with the integrity as well as safety of SQL Server.

Before you try to convert an Access database to SQL Server, see to it you recognize:

Which applications belong in Microsoft Access vs. SQL Server? Not every data source ought to be changed.
The reasons for upsizing your data source. Ensure SQL Server offers you exactly what you look for.

The tradeoffs for doing so. There are pluses and also minuses depending on exactly what you're aiming to enhance. my website Make sure you are not moving to SQL Server entirely for efficiency reasons.
In a lot of cases, performance lowers when an application is upsized, specifically for fairly small data sources (under 200 MB).

Some efficiency concerns are unrelated to the backend data source. Poorly developed questions as well as table layout won't be fixed by upsizing. Microsoft Gain access to tables supply some features that SQL Server tables do not such as an automatic refresh when the information adjustments. SQL Server requires an explicit requery.

Options for Migrating Microsoft Accessibility to SQL Server
There are numerous alternatives for hosting SQL Server databases:

A local instance of SQL Express, which is a complimentary variation of SQL Server can be mounted on each customer's maker

A common SQL Server database on your network

A cloud host such as SQL Azure. Cloud hosts have protection that restriction which IP addresses could obtain information, so set IP addresses and/or VPN is needed.
There are several methods to upsize your Microsoft Accessibility data sources to SQL Server:

Relocate the data to SQL Server and also connect to it from your Access database while maintaining the existing Accessibility application.
Changes could be should sustain SQL Server inquiries as well as differences from Access databases.
Transform an Access MDB data source to an Accessibility Data Task (ADP) that attaches straight to a SQL Server data source.
Considering that ADPs were deprecated in Access 2013, we do not recommend this choice.
Use Microsoft Gain Access To with MS Azure.
With Office365, your information is posted right into a SQL Server data source hosted by SQL Azure with a Gain access to Internet front end
Appropriate for standard viewing and editing of information across the web
Sadly, Access Internet Applications do not have the customization features similar to VBA in Access desktop options
Move the entire application to the.NET Structure, ASP.NET, and SQL Server platform, or recreate it on SharePoint.
A crossbreed option that puts the data in SQL Server with another front-end plus a Gain access to front-end data source.
SQL Server can be the traditional variation held on a venture top quality server or a free SQL Server Express version mounted on your COMPUTER

Database Difficulties in a Company

Every company needs to get over data source difficulties to meet their objective. These obstacles include:
• Optimizing roi
• Handling personnels
• Rapid implementation
• Adaptability and maintainability
• Scalability (additional).

Maximizing Return on Investment.

Making best use of roi is a lot more important compared to ever. Management requires substantial results for the expensive investments in data source application advancement. Several database advancement initiatives cannot generate the outcomes they promise. Choosing the right technology and approach for each and every degree in an organization is crucial to optimizing return on investment. This implies choosing the most effective overall return, which doesn't imply picking the least expensive initial service. This is typically one of the most essential decision a chief information police officer (CIO) or primary innovation policeman (CTO) makes.

Handling Human Resources.

Managing individuals to tailor technology is challenging. The even more complicated the technology or application, the less people are qualified to manage it, as well as the a lot more pricey they are to hire. Turn over is constantly a concern, as well as having the right standards is essential to efficiently supporting tradition applications. Training as well as staying up to date with innovation are likewise challenging.

Fast Deployment.

Producing database applications quickly is important, not only for minimizing expenses, but for reacting to internal or client needs. The capability to develop applications promptly offers a substantial visit competitive advantage.

The IT manager is in charge of providing alternatives as well as making tradeoffs to sustain the business requirements of the organization. By utilizing different innovations, you could provide service choice makers options, such as a 60 percent remedy in 3 months, a 90 percent solution in twelve months, or a 99 percent remedy in twenty-four months. (Instead of months, it could be dollars.) Occasionally, time to market is most crucial, various other times it may be price, as well as various other times attributes or safety and security are essential. Requirements transform promptly and are unforeseeable. We reside in a "sufficient" rather than an excellent world, so recognizing the best ways to provide "sufficient" services quickly gives you and your company an one-upmanship.

Adaptability and also Maintainability.
Despite having the best system design, by the time multiple month development efforts are completed, requires adjustment. Variations adhere to variations, as well as a system that's created to be versatile and able to accommodate change could suggest the distinction in between success as well as failure for the users' careers.


Equipment needs to be created to handle the expected data and even more. However numerous systems are never finished, are disposed of soon, or change a lot gradually that the initial assessments are wrong. Scalability is important, yet often lesser than a fast option. If the application successfully sustains growth, scalability can be included later when it's financially warranted.

Leave a Reply

Your email address will not be published. Required fields are marked *